Why Use an Excel Loan Calculator?

Excel spreadsheets offer several advantages over web-based calculators:

  • Full Customization: Adjust formulas, add extra columns (e.g., early payments, fees), or integrate with other financial sheets.
  • Offline Access: No internet required—ideal for sensitive financial planning.
  • Scenario Testing: Compare different loan terms, interest rates, or extra payments side-by-side.
  • Data Retention: Save and track multiple loans over time in one file.
  • Advanced Features: Incorporate amortization schedules, graphs, or conditional formatting for deeper insights.

Key Components of a Loan Calculator Excel Sheet

A well-designed Excel loan calculator should include:

  1. Input Section: Cells for loan amount, interest rate, term, and payment frequency.
  2. Calculation Engine: Formulas to compute monthly payments, total interest, and payoff dates.
    • =PMT(rate, nper, pv): Calculates fixed payments.
    • =IPMT(rate, per, nper, pv): Computes interest portion of a payment.
    • =PPMT(rate, per, nper, pv): Computes principal portion.
  3. Amortization Schedule: A table showing each payment’s breakdown (principal vs. interest) over time.
  4. Summary Section: High-level metrics like total interest paid and payoff date.
  5. Visualizations: Charts to illustrate interest vs. principal over the loan term.

Step-by-Step: Build Your Own Excel Loan Calculator

Follow these steps to create a basic loan calculator in Excel:

1. Set Up the Input Section

Create labeled cells for:

  • Loan Amount (P): e.g., $25,000
  • Annual Interest Rate (r): e.g., 5.5%
  • Loan Term (t): e.g., 5 years
  • Payment Frequency: Monthly, bi-weekly, or weekly

2. Calculate the Monthly Payment

Use the PMT function:

=PMT(annual_rate/12, term_in_months, loan_amount)
            

Example: For a $25,000 loan at 5.5% over 5 years:

=PMT(5.5%/12, 5*12, 25000)  → Returns $477.45
            

3. Generate an Amortization Schedule

Create a table with columns for:

  • Payment Number
  • Payment Date
  • Payment Amount
  • Principal Paid
  • Interest Paid
  • Remaining Balance

Use PPMT and IPMT to populate the principal and interest columns. The remaining balance decreases with each payment.

4. Add Summary Metrics

Include cells for:

  • Total Interest Paid: =SUM(interest_column)
  • Total Payments: =monthly_payment * term_in_months
  • Payoff Date: =EDATE(start_date, term_in_months)

5. Visualize with Charts

Insert a stacked column chart to show principal vs. interest over time, or a line chart for the remaining balance trend.

Advanced Excel Loan Calculator Features

Take your spreadsheet to the next level with these pro tips:

1. Add Extra Payments

Include a column for additional payments to see how they reduce the loan term and interest. Use:

=IF(payment_number <= extra_payment_period, extra_payment_amount, 0)
            

2. Compare Loan Scenarios

Duplicate your calculator sheet to compare:

  • 15-year vs. 30-year mortgages
  • Fixed vs. variable rates
  • Different down payments

3. Incorporate Fees and Taxes

Add rows for:

  • Origination fees
  • Property taxes (for mortgages)
  • Insurance premiums

4. Automate with Macros

Use VBA to:

  • Auto-populate payment dates
  • Generate PDF reports
  • Email summaries

Expert Tips for Using Loan Calculators

  1. Verify Rates: Always use the actual interest rate from your lender (not the APR, which includes fees).
  2. Account for Fees: Add origination fees or points to the loan amount for accurate calculations.
  3. Test Scenarios: Run multiple scenarios (e.g., 15-year vs. 30-year terms) to find the best fit for your budget.
  4. Check Amortization: Review the schedule to see how much interest you pay upfront (typically 70%+ of early payments go to interest).
  5. Plan for Extra Payments: Even small additional payments (e.g., $50/month) can save thousands in interest.
  6. Update Regularly: Recalculate if rates change or you make lump-sum payments.

Common Mistakes to Avoid

  • Ignoring Compound Frequency: Ensure your calculator uses the correct compounding period (e.g., monthly vs. annually).
  • Mixing APR and Interest Rate: APR includes fees; use the nominal interest rate for calculations.
  • Overlooking Escrow: For mortgages, remember to add property taxes and insurance to your monthly budget.
  • Static Assumptions: Interest rates or incomes may change—revisit your calculations periodically.
  • Not Validating Results: Cross-check with your lender's numbers or a second calculator.

Frequently Asked Questions

1. Can I use Excel to calculate car loans or personal loans?

Yes! The same PMT function works for any fixed-rate loan. For car loans, add cells for sales tax, registration fees, and trade-in values.

2. How do I calculate interest-only payments in Excel?

Use =P*r for the interest portion, where P is the principal and r is the periodic interest rate (e.g., annual rate/12).

3. Why does my Excel calculator show a different payment than my lender?

Common reasons:

  • Your lender may include fees in the APR.
  • Round-up policies (e.g., payments rounded to the nearest dollar).
  • Different compounding periods (e.g., daily vs. monthly).

4. Can I create a loan calculator for variable interest rates?

Yes, but it requires advanced Excel skills:

  • Use separate rows for each rate change period.
  • Adjust the rate argument in PMT for each segment.
  • Consider using IF statements or a helper column for rate changes.

5. How do I add a prepayment penalty to my Excel calculator?

Create a conditional column:

=IF(AND(payment_number <= penalty_period, remaining_balance > prepayment_threshold),
   remaining_balance * penalty_percentage, 0)
